Dinging Your Way To Your Customers

Chuck Zimmerman

NAMA Agribusiness ForumAt the NAMA Agribusiness Forum it was interesting to see a presentation on customer focused marketing from a very non-ag company. Southwest Airlines started Ding earlier this year as a way to interact very closely with their customers. Jill Howard-Allen had quite a few questions after her presentation. I think that people found her presentation to be very different than what they expected.
